LOSING COLLEAGUES IN THE SUEZ CRISIS
A very emotional John Mitchell talks about how, a year after he had flown home from the Suez Canal zone, he heard the news that two good friends has tragically lost their lives - on a flight home having been demobbed.
CONSCRIPTION IN 1953
In 1953 John Mitchell was 18 and was called up via conscription to be trained in the RAF. Here he talks about how the post-war conscription process worked.
ARRIVAL IN THE SUEZ CANAL ZONE 1953
Leading Aircraftman John Mitchell was conscripted into the RAF in 1953 at the age of 18. Straight after basic training he was sent out to the Middle East with no idea where he was headed or what role they were going to play, made worse still by a colleague calling it 'the worst posting in the world'. Here he describes getting out there and first impressions of desert life.
FACING DANGER IN SUEZ CANAL ZONE
Leading Aircraftman John Mitchell was conscripted in 1953 at the age of 18 to go to the Suez Canal zone where he spent 2 years working on one of the military bases. Here he talks about a particular incident that happened to him when he was in a local village, away from the safety of the base.
